Machine Learning Engineer Remote with occasional travel to Silver Spring, MD
About @Orchard:
@Orchard is a growing Woman-Owned Small Business and federal prime contractor delivering mission-critical science, data, technology, program management, and workforce solutions. Since 2010, we have built high-performing teams and disciplined delivery systems that help federal agencies launch complex programs, sustain performance, and achieve meaningful mission outcomes.
Position Summary:
@Orchard LLC is seeking an Machine Learning Engineer to support the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A), Office of Ocean Exploration.
The Machine Learning Engineer will develop and apply machine learning capabilities to help NOAA Ocean Exploration analyze the large volumes of scientific data and video generated during ocean exploration expeditions. Working at the intersection of computer science, marine science, and data analytics, this position will develop software, algorithms, and analytical workflows that help identify scientifically significant characteristics, fauna, shapes, movement, and other features within complex scientific datasets and video streams.
The successful candidate will collaborate with marine scientists, engineers, data specialists, and other technical professionals to improve the efficiency and consistency of scientific data analysis. The role will help reduce manual review time, support annotation and characterization of observations, and create repeatable tools that enable scientists to extract meaningful information from increasingly large ocean exploration datasets.
This position is contingent upon contract award.
Mission Impact:
This position applies emerging AI and machine learning technologies to one of the world's most challenging data environments-ocean exploration. Your work will help NOAA scientists analyze massive volumes of expedition data and video more efficiently, accelerating the identification and characterization of marine life and other scientifically significant observations.
Key Responsibilities:
AI & Machine Learning Development
  • Develop machine learning capabilities for evaluating large volumes of ocean exploration data and streaming video.
  • Design, develop, test, and refine algorithms and software that identify specific characteristics, shapes, movement, fauna, and other features within scientific data and video.
  • Develop computer-language subroutines, scripts, and programs that support automated or semi-automated data analysis, annotation, and characterization.
  • Apply appropriate machine learning and computer vision techniques to improve the efficiency and consistency of scientific data review.
  • Evaluate model performance and refine approaches based on scientific objectives and observed results.

Scientific Data & Video Analysis
  • Work with large scientific datasets and high-volume expedition video to identify patterns and features relevant to ocean exploration.
  • Collaborate with marine scientists to translate scientific questions and observation requirements into computational approaches.
  • Support development of tools that enable scientists to efficiently locate, annotate, classify, and characterize observations.
  • Assist in developing repeatable analytical workflows that can be applied to future expeditions and datasets.
  • Support integration of AI/ML outputs into broader scientific data analysis, annotation, and ocean exploration workflows.

Software Development & Documentation
  • Develop maintainable and reusable code supporting machine learning and data-analysis capabilities.
  • Document software development, algorithms, workflows, model changes, and system updates to support future corrections and enhancements.
  • Test and troubleshoot applications and analytical workflows to ensure reliable performance.
  • Recommend improvements to software, analytical methods, and machine learning workflows.
  • Support software corrections and updates as required.

Scientific Collaboration
  • Collaborate with marine scientists, GIS specialists, web developers, engineers, and other technical professionals.
  • Participate in technical discussions, scientific meetings, and project planning activities.
  • Translate technical machine learning concepts into understandable information for scientific and program stakeholders.
  • Support technical reports, presentations, demonstrations, and other program deliverables.

Operational Support
  • Support response to urgent software or analytical issues affecting supported capabilities, including occasional work outside normal business hours when required
  • Support troubleshooting and resolution of issues affecting machine learning applications and associated web or data capabilities.
